Transaction def00b05dc108cd680332616df71100dddd6f05fbc86ea726624f29baa79db65
1 Input
1 Output
-
def00b05dc108cd680332616df71100dddd6f05fbc86ea726624f29baa79db65:0
- value
- 66136132
- script pubkey
- OP_0 OP_PUSHBYTES_20 b5b1b8d39c4265ceb8c9bda2710a500104aa1c6a
- address
- bc1qkkcm35uugfjuawxfhk38zzjsqyz258r2ncmpg5